Concert Season Begins Saturday, May 13 at Klipsch Music Center. Expect Increased Traffic Around Concert Times.

Concert season at Klipsch Music Center starts this weekend with a large concert scheduled Saturday, May 13. More than 20,000 fans may attend some of the larger concerts creating a rapid, short-lived influx of traffic. Motorists traveling in the area of the concert venue should expect increased traffic, generally beginning around two hours before concert time. Access to Hamilton Town Center and other businesses and restaurants as well as traffic at Exit 210 (Campus Parkway) of I-69 may be affected by concert traffic.

With construction along I-69 and State Road 37, concert goers and area residents should plan extra time to reach destinations. Travelers from the north may want to consider using Exit 214 from I-69 and traveling State Road 38 to Klipsch Music Center.

In addition to deputies and officers assisting traffic flow around Klipsch Music Center, the Hamilton County Traffic Safety Partnership regularly patrols the area to promote traffic safety, especially compliance with Indiana’s seatbelt and impaired driving laws. Please remember to buckle up and if using alcohol, do so responsibly. The Traffic Safety Partnership is composed of the Hamilton County Sheriff’s Office, Carmel Police, Cicero Police, Fishers Police, Noblesville Police, and Westfield Police along with assistance from the Indiana State Police.
